Long-Term Operational Reliability
Infrastructure equipment is designed for many years of operation in public environments. Product design, material selection, and manufacturing technologies must ensure outstanding mechanical durability, stable visual quality, and resistance to intensive use.
Premium Visual Quality
Products are highly visible elements of public infrastructure and are subject to acceptance inspections based on stringent visual quality standards. Customers expect flawless surfaces, freedom from scratches, burrs, and distortions, consistent directional surface finishing, and precisely finished edges to ensure user safety.
Resistance to Environmental Conditions
Equipment operates both indoors and outdoors, often in high-humidity environments or coastal areas. This requires advanced corrosion protection systems, durable protective coatings, and materials capable of delivering long-term environmental resistance.
Resistance to Mechanical Damage and Vandalism
Products installed in public spaces must provide a high level of resistance to mechanical damage, break-in attempts, and acts of vandalism.
Leak Tightness and Operational Safety
Equipment enclosures must achieve high IP protection ratings and ensure reliable sealing of all structural joints. Proper selection of manufacturing technologies directly affects the reliability of electronic systems and the overall safety of the equipment.
Integration of Multiple Technologies
Modern infrastructure equipment combines mechanical, electrical, electronic, and automation systems. Their production requires seamless integration of multiple manufacturing technologies within a single production process.
Management of Multiple Product Configurations
Infrastructure equipment is frequently customized to meet the requirements of individual investors, operators, or local markets. Manufacturing therefore requires efficient management of multiple design variants, optional equipment, and color configurations while maintaining complete quality consistency.
